Trend #10 – Tactile Surfaces

Beyond just visual aesthetics, homeowners are seeking cabinets with finishes that engage the sense of touch. These textured surfaces add depth, character, and a tactile appeal to your kitchen. The trend embraces a range of materials and finishes, from rough-hewn woods to textured laminates and embossed metals.

Not only do tactile surfaces provide a unique and captivating visual element to your kitchen, but they also offer practical advantages. Textured cabinets can hide fingerprints, scratches, and wear-and-tear better than their smooth counterparts, making them a smart choice for high-traffic kitchens.

Trend #11 – Matte Finishes

Matte finishes are making a significant impact in kitchen cabinet trends, offering a sophisticated and understated elegance that glossy finishes often lack. The appeal of matte finishes lies in their ability to create a smooth, non-reflective surface that exudes a modern and sleek aesthetic. Unlike high-gloss finishes, matte surfaces are excellent at hiding fingerprints, smudges, and scratches, making them one of the go-to choices for busy kitchens.

Available in a variety of colors, from muted neutrals to bold shades, matte finishes on kitchen cabinets can complement any design style, from contemporary to rustic. Whether you prefer a minimalist look or something more eclectic, matte finishes provide a versatile canvas for creating a chic and inviting kitchen space.

Trend #14 – White Oak Cabinet Doors

White oak cabinet doors are gaining popularity in for their timeless beauty and natural appeal. Known for its durability and distinctive grain pattern, white cabinets made from natural oak offers a warm and inviting look that works well in both traditional and contemporary kitchens.

The light, neutral tone of white cabinets can brighten up a space and create a sense of openness, making it ideal for smaller kitchens or those lacking in natural light. Additionally, white oak is highly versatile and can be stained or painted to match any interior design preference. Its inherent strength and resistance to wear make white oak a practical choice for kitchen cabinets, ensuring they look beautiful and last for years to come.

Trend #17 – Minimalist Handles or Handle-less Cabinets

One of the most exciting kitchen cabinet trends for is the rise of minimalist handles or handle-less cabinets. This sleek, modern look emphasizes clean lines and an uncluttered feel, making the kitchen appear more open and streamlined. Handle-less cabinets often use push-to-open mechanisms or integrated grips, eliminating the need for traditional knobs or pulls.

This trend not only enhances the aesthetic appeal of contemporary kitchens but also adds to the functional ease, offering a seamless way to access storage without interrupting the smooth surfaces of the cabinetry.
